原创 单片机C语言日记十一

2008-12-24 16:58 2165 4 4 分类: MCU/ 嵌入式

基本语句:<?xml:namespace prefix = o ns = "urn:schemas-microsoft-com:office:office" />


1.表达式语句


在表达式的后面加上一个分号,就构成了表达式语句。


2.复合语句


{}将若干条语句组合在一起而形成的一种功能块。


3.条件语句


if关键字构成,三种形式:


1if(条件表达式) 语句;


2if(条件表达式) 语句1


     else 语句2


3if(条件表达式1 语句1


     else if(条件表达式2)语句2


else if(条件表达式3)语句3


……


else if(条件表达式n)语句n


else 语句m


4.开关语句


switch关键字与case构成,形式:


switch(表达式)


{


  case 常量表达式1:语句1break


case 常量表达式2:语句2break


……


case 常量表达式n:语句nbreak


default:语句mbreak


}


5.循环语句


四种形式:


1)采用while语句


while(条件表达式) 语句;


2)采用do-while语句


do 语句 while(条件表达式);


3)采用for语句


for[初值设定表达式][循环条件表达式][更新表达式] 语句


4goto语句(结构化编程中尽量少用)


无条件转向语句,形式:


goto 语句标号;


比较gotobreakcontinue语句:


goto语句可从内层循环跳出外层循环,并可跳出多层循环。


break语句可立即从内一层循环跳出到外一层循环。


continue语句在循环语句中可结束当次循环或跳向下次循环。


6.返回语句


终止函数的执行,并控制程序返回到调用该函数所处的位置。


形式:return(表达式);


函数可以忽略返回值,return语句后面也不一定需要表达式。

PARTNER CONTENT

文章评论0条评论)

登录后参与讨论
EE直播间
更多
我要评论
0
4
关闭 站长推荐上一条 /3 下一条